Output ac32ab746f8b7dc173d20046469c6542cebe80d3dca147e93c91bf664c7634b3:24

value
11005517
script pubkey
OP_0 OP_PUSHBYTES_32 dc2d38abf731461d9a4d1bd2bdc5984f9808e266a4f8fb065a4e1d2b7565c805
address
bc1qmskn32lhx9rpmxjdr0ftm3vcf7vq3cnx5nu0kpj6fcwjkat9eqzsey90du
transaction
ac32ab746f8b7dc173d20046469c6542cebe80d3dca147e93c91bf664c7634b3
confirmations
157020
spent
true